1. A system for carrying an instrument panel for a motor vehicle, the instrument panel including a steering shaft assembly for receiving a steering wheel, the system comprising:

  • a decking arm assembly comprising;

    a support structure for supporting the instrument panel;

    an actuator disposed proximate the support structure, the actuator being moveable between an advanced position and a retracted position;

    a cradle disposed proximate the actuator for engaging the steering shaft assembly; and

    a sensor assembly disposed proximate the support structure for detecting the position of the decking arm assembly relative to the motor vehicle, the sensor assembly having an arm that contacts an A-pillar of the motor vehicle when the instrument panel is in a desired installation position;

    wherein the cradle engages the steering shaft assembly when the actuator is in the advanced position and the sensor assembly does not indicate that the instrument panel is in the desired installation position.
